The rubber tree ( Hevea brasiliensis, family-Euphorbiaceae), is native to the rainforests of the Amazon which includes Brazil, Venezuela, Peru, and Bolivia. It grows to about 40 m in height and has latex vessels in its bark. When the bark of a mature tree is cut, a milky latex of rubber oozes out which is collected for commercial purposes.rubber tree, (Hevea brasiliensis), South American tropical tree of the spurge family (Euphorbiaceae). Rubber Tree The rubber tree (Hevea brasiliensis) is a deciduous species native to the rainforests of the Amazon basin and found in Brazil, Venezuela, Ecuador, Colombia, Bolivia and Peru. It is mostly encountered in lowland moist forest habitats, including disturbed forest, wetland areas, and forest clearings. 19-Dec-2015 ...
